| With flourishing of regional economic integration,more and more regional free trade agreements have been signed.Preferential duty is the most important part of the regional free trade agreement.Goods enjoying the preferential duty should be native to a specific region.The certificate of origin is a critically important way of origin certification.Compared with the certificate of origin,the declaration of origin has advantages,including a low administrative cost,convenience,quick acquisition,etc.These advantages are in line with the economic development trends of the current society.At present,the declaration of origin can mainly be divided into two models,namely North American model and pan-European model.Under each model,the declaration of certificate has its own characteristics.By comparing China’ s free trade agreement(FTA)with the North American model and pan-European model,this paper explores the rules of the declaration of origin suitable for China’ s national conditions.To start with,this paper analyzes and summarizes legal issues concerning the declaration of origin.Following that,the similarities and differences of the origin declaration rules of the regional FTA under the North American model and the pan-European model are analyzed and compared.Their advantages and disadvantages are pointed out,respectively.Finally,combining China ’ s current clauses for the declaration of origin and the advantages and disadvantages of different origin declaration rules,this paper puts forward feasible suggestions for the declaration of origin in FTAs to be signed by China. |
